"In the 2012 presidential election, Republicans lost women by 11 percentage points. Over the last two years, the GOP has wrapped its same, out-of-touch policies in different packaging and expected a different result. If doing the same thing over and over and expecting different results is insanity—then it's about time we got Republicans committed.
The GOP's autopsy, trainings and memos made one thing very clear: The party does not understand that its problem with female voters has nothing to do with presentation, rhetoric or outreach. The problem is, and has always been, Republican policies.
Policies that prevent us from moving closer to equal pay for women, policies that would make it more difficult for women to exercise their right to vote, policies that would allow insurance companies to discriminate against women and policies that would allow politicians and employers to get involved in medical decisions that belong between a woman and her doctor.
So it didn't surprise me when I read in this most recent poll, leaked to Politico, that Democrats hold a 40 percent advantage on the question of who "looks out for the interests of women." Then there are findings like the one showing women "believe that 'enforcing equal pay for equal work' is the policy that would 'help women the most.'" Did the GOP really need a poll to tell them that?
